Mancera demonstrates high information density by replacing generic marketing fluff with technical scent profiles. Product pages like Amberful specify exact ingredients such as Pink Pepper, Japanese Yuzu, and Calabrian Bergamot rather than vague ‘exotic scents.’ The body substance ratio is favorable, anchoring the brand’s ‘French elegance’ claim with specific pricing (€100.00-€170.00) and volume data (120ml, 5x2ml).

Semantic drift is near zero; the homepage signal of ‘Niche Perfumes’ is directly supported by the sub-pages which provide granular detail on gourmand and oriental olfactory families. There is no disconnect between the luxury positioning on the homepage and the actual deliverables, as pricing and physical store locations (68 rue Pierre Charron, Paris) remain consistent across the site’s architecture.

The brand uses some industry-standard luxury tropes like ‘French elegance’ and ‘ancestral knowledge,’ which are common in the fragrance sector. However, the unique value proposition regarding a ‘family collaboration’ and specific ‘nomadic formats’ for travel sets prevents the site from feeling like a generic copy-paste template. The template language in the footer and product suggestion blocks is standard for e-commerce but filled with brand-specific content.

There is a minor authority gap regarding the ‘expert’ behind the ancestral knowledge mentioned in the ‘House of Mancera’ section, as no specific individual is named in the text or identified via Person schema. However, the inclusion of a verifiable physical address in Paris and a direct customer service telephone number in the Organization schema provides a level of legitimacy that offsets the anonymity of the founders.

Mancera avoids making hyperbolic performance claims such as ‘lasts 48 hours’ or ‘guaranteed compliments,’ which are common in lower-tier fragrance marketing. Instead, it describes scents as an ‘invitation to la dolce vita,’ which, while subjective, is an industry-standard artistic descriptor rather than an unsubstantiated performance metric.
